Hi!

I have a problem with the function "Edit multiple adjacency".

So my building is on the slope, where half of the ground floor is actually under ground. I created sloped shaped and assigned it as adjacent building. From what I got on the forum, than I went to the surface level of this adjacent shape and switched to the apache tab, so now the function "edit multiple adjacency". Following the logic I assign surfaces to ground floor with the temperature from profile - typical ground temperature. And at this point I have couple questions:

1. How can I do it to several surfaces at ones? My slope is complicated shape and has many surfaces (like 20) and the function not allowed me to highlight them together or at least I do it wrong.
2. After I assigned the temperature from profile following above described steps, I opened the adjacency function on the same surface again and the marks on the options showing that it has assigned typical ground temperature disappeared. So how would I check if it really assigned?

Does anyone have any suggestions?
